Bob and Dannah Gresh\'s marriage has traveled dark roads of addiction. But they decided to participate in God\'s redemption story. Together, they discovered something better than romance: a love that endures, and happily even after.

It\\u2019s so much easier to pretend everything is okay and to just keep going through the motions. That\\u2019s not okay. What that is, is us avoiding pain. Pain is not a problem. It is a gift from God. When you feel the pain, that\\u2019s God\\u2019s friendly messenger saying, \\u201cThere\\u2019s something that together we can fix if you\\u2019re willing to be brave enough and feel the pain.\\u201d --Dannah Gresh
